The composition of rubber roofing shingles typically involves recycled rubber, combined with other materials to enhance their performance. The primary component is ethylene propylene diene monomer (EPDM), a synthetic rubber known for its resilience and weather resistance. These shingles are designed to mimic the appearance of traditional materials like wood or slate, offering an aesthetic appeal without the associated drawbacks. The manufacturing process involves melting down recycled rubber, adding pigments and stabilizers, and molding it into shingle forms. This not only reduces waste but also contributes to a circular economy, making rubber roofing shingles an environmentally conscious choice.
One of the standout benefits of rubber roofing shingles is their exceptional durability. They are resistant to extreme temperatures, UV radiation, and moisture, which helps prevent issues like cracking, warping, or mold growth. Additionally, rubber shingles have a long lifespan, often lasting 30 to 50 years with proper maintenance. This longevity translates to fewer replacements and repairs, ultimately saving homeowners money over time. Another advantage is their energy efficiency; rubber shingles provide excellent insulation, reducing heat transfer and lowering heating and cooling costs. Their lightweight nature also means less stress on the roof structure, making them suitable for a wide range of buildings.
Installation of rubber roofing shingles is relatively straightforward, but it requires professional expertise to ensure optimal performance. The process begins with a thorough inspection of the existing roof to address any underlying issues. Next, an underlayment is applied to provide an additional layer of protection against moisture. The shingles are then nailed or adhered to the roof deck in overlapping rows, similar to traditional shingle installation. Proper sealing at the edges and around penetrations like vents or chimneys is crucial to prevent leaks. While DIY installation is possible, hiring a certified contractor is recommended to avoid common pitfalls and ensure warranty compliance.
Maintenance for rubber roofing shingles is minimal compared to other materials. Regular inspections, especially after severe weather, can help identify minor issues before they escalate. Cleaning the roof with a soft brush or low-pressure wash removes debris and prevents staining. It’s also important to check for any signs of damage, such as punctures or loose shingles, and address them promptly. Most manufacturers offer warranties that cover defects, but proper maintenance is often a requirement to keep the warranty valid. With routine care, rubber shingles can maintain their appearance and functionality for decades.
When comparing rubber roofing shingles to other materials, several factors come into play. Asphalt shingles, for example, are cheaper upfront but have a shorter lifespan and higher environmental impact due to petroleum-based production. Wood shingles offer a natural look but are prone to fire, rot, and insect damage. Slate and tile shingles are durable but heavy and expensive. Rubber shingles strike a balance by offering durability, affordability, and sustainability. They are also more impact-resistant than asphalt, making them ideal for areas prone to hail or falling debris. However, they may not be suitable for all architectural styles, as their appearance might not match historical or specific design preferences.
In terms of cost, rubber roofing shingles are a mid-range option. The initial investment is higher than asphalt but lower than premium materials like slate. The long-term savings from reduced maintenance and energy bills often justify the upfront cost. Additionally, many regions offer incentives or rebates for using eco-friendly roofing materials, further enhancing their affordability. Homeowners should consider obtaining multiple quotes from contractors to compare prices and services. It’s also wise to check for certifications, such as ENERGY STAR or LEED, which can indicate high quality and environmental standards.
Environmental benefits are a major selling point for rubber roofing shingles. By utilizing recycled materials, they help reduce landfill waste and conserve natural resources. The production process consumes less energy compared to virgin material manufacturing, resulting in a lower carbon footprint. At the end of their life, rubber shingles can often be recycled again, promoting a sustainable lifecycle. Furthermore, their energy-efficient properties contribute to lower greenhouse gas emissions from buildings. For environmentally conscious consumers, these factors make rubber shingles an attractive option.
